Cottages are perfect for travelers who enjoy feeling cozy and independent in the countryside. Usually small, traditionally built houses, cottages are spread across one or two floors – making them great for families or vacations with a little more privacy.

If you love hiking, I’d highly recommend the hikes out of Corniglia. I also would not recommend bringing large (or even small!) suitcases as it is a climb up and is on stone walkways. Bring a backpack with your essentials, and you’ll enjoy your time much more!
